Dendronotoidea Allman, 1845
Dendronotida · unaccepted
Dendronotina · unaccepted
Family Bornellidae Bergh, 1874
Family Dendronotidae Allman, 1845
Family Dotidae Gray, 1853
Family Hancockiidae MacFarland, 1923
Family Lomanotidae Bergh, 1890
Family Phylliroidae Menke, 1830
Family Scyllaeidae Alder & Hancock, 1855
Family Tethydidae Rafinesque, 1815
Family Dactylopodidae Bonnevie, 1931 accepted as Phylliroidae Menke, 1830
Family Fimbriidae O'Donoghue, 1926 accepted as Tethydidae Rafinesque, 1815 (invalid: type genus a junior homonym)
Family Iduliidae Iredale & O'Donoghue, 1923 accepted as Dotidae Gray, 1853
Family Melibidae Forbes, 1844 accepted as Tethydidae Rafinesque, 1815
Family Nectophyllirhoidae Hoffmann, 1922 accepted as Phylliroidae Menke, 1830
Family Tethymelibidae Bergh, 1890 accepted as Tethydidae Rafinesque, 1815 (not available: not based on a genus)
